🔰基礎技術

Webの仕組みを最新情報で解説|サーバー・ドメイン・IPアドレスとは?

2026年1月11日

プログラミング学習を始めると、最初にぶつかる壁が「Webの仕組み」です。
IPアドレス、DNS、サーバー、クライアント……。横文字ばかりで頭が痛くなりますよね。

「とりあえずレンタルサーバーを借りればいいの?」

この疑問に対する答えは、「あなたが何を作りたいか」によって変わります。
ブログを作りたいならレンタルサーバーが正解ですが、モダンなWebアプリ(SaaS)を作りたいなら、実はレンタルサーバーは借りない方がいい場合が多いのです。

この記事では、Webの仕組みを「土地と店舗」に例えて解説し、「ブログ運営(WordPress)」と「アプリ開発(Next.js等)」それぞれで選ぶべきサーバーの正解を提示します。

「更地」を借りますか?「商業施設のテナント」に入りますか?

仕組みの話の前に、まずは読者の皆さんが一番知りたい「結局どれを使えばいいの?」という結論からお伝えします。

🏆 目的別:サーバー選びの最適解

  • WordPressでブログをやりたい 👉 レンタルサーバー(Xserver / ConoHa WING 等)
    理由:設定が直感的で、管理画面からクリックだけでブログを開設できる
  • Next.js等でWebアプリ・SaaSを開発したい 👉 Vercel / Firebase(PaaS / Serverless)
    理由:裏側の設定を自動化でき、個人開発なら「無料枠」で高性能な環境が使える

1. Webの基本:ブラウザとサーバーの「やりとり」で成り立つ

まず、一番基礎的な部分です。私たちが普段見ているWebサイトやアプリは、実は「依頼(リクエスト)」と「返事(レスポンス)」の繰り返しで成り立っています。

  • クライアント(あなた): スマホやPC(ブラウザ)。「このページが見たい!」と依頼する側。
  • サーバー: データや処理を提供するコンピュータ。「はい、どうぞ」とデータを返事する側。

あなたがこのページを開いた瞬間、裏側では「記事のデータをください」「OK、これだよ」というやりとりが行われています。
このやりとりを成立させるために必要なのが、次項で解説する「土地」「店名」「場所(住所)」の関係です。

2. 例え話で理解する:「土地」と「店舗」と「店名」と「地図」

伝統的な例え話ですが、サーバーやドメイン、DNSの役割は、土地とお店に例えるとわかりやすいです。

  • サーバー = 「土地」
    Web上のデータを置いておくための場所です。
  • Webサイト/アプリ = 「店舗(建物)」
    土地の上に建てる店舗です。HTMLやプログラムのコードがこれにあたります。
  • ドメイン = 「店名」
    google.comsimplekits.tech のこと。人が覚えやすい名前で、目的のお店(サイト/アプリ)を指します。
  • URL =「店名+商品」
    https://www.simplekits.tech/〜 のこと。店舗内の商品(記事/機能)を指します。
  • IPアドレス =「店舗住所」
    192.168.xxx.xxx のこと。店舗の住所を指します。

💡 DNS(ドメイン・ネーム・システム)とは?
インターネット上で「店舗の場所」を示すのは、本来 IPアドレス(例:192.0.2.123 のような数字)です。
ただ、数字の住所は人間には覚えにくい。そこで、「店名(ドメイン)」から「店舗の場所(IPアドレス)」を特定してくれる仕組みがDNSです。
イメージとしては、「店名を入れると場所(住所)を案内してくれる地図」がDNSだと思ってください。

3. レンタルサーバー vs Vercel(PaaS)比較表

さて、ここからが本題です。個人開発者が選ぶべきは「どっちの出店スタイルにするか」という話です。

項目レンタルサーバー
(Xserver, ConoHaなど)
モダンPaaS / Serverless
(Vercel, Firebaseなど)
イメージ「更地を借りて店舗を建てる」
自由だが、設備・保守・セキュリティも自分で管理
「商業施設のテナントに入る」
設備・保守が揃っていて、運用の手間が少ない
WordPress◎(最適)
WordPressの「即開店セット」が用意されていて、導入が一瞬で終わる
△(不向き)
WordPress前提の設備がないため、組み込みが手間になりがち
自作アプリ
(Next.js等)
△(面倒)
自作アプリの“即開店セット”がないので、運用まで自前で整える必要がある
(※インフラの知識が必要)
◎(最高)
自作アプリ向けの設備が揃っていて、公開・運用が容易
コスト感月額 1,000円〜無料枠から開始しやすい(従量課金)
※商用で継続運用するなら、有料プラン($20/月〜)に移行する

直感的で分かりやすい「レンタルサーバー」

レンタルサーバーは、管理画面が日本語で親切に作られており、「ここにファイルを置けば表示されるんだな」という感覚が掴みやすいのがメリットです。
WordPressでブログを書くなら、迷わずこちらを選びましょう。「Xserver」「ConoHa WING」などが国内では定番で、ドメイン(店名)もセットで管理できるため初心者でも迷子になりにくいです。

WEBアプリ開発者の新常識「Vercel / Firebase」

一方、プログラミングをしてWebアプリを作る場合、レンタルサーバーの「管理の手間」は邪魔になります。
そこで、2025年以降の個人開発では「Vercel(バーセル)」のようなプラットフォームが主流です。

これは、空調や警備、共用設備が最初から整った「商業施設のテナント」のようなものです。
あなたは「お店の中身(WEBアプリ)」に集中すればよく、面倒なサーバー設定やセキュリティ対策の多くをプラットフォーム側が肩代わりしてくれます。

しかも、個人の趣味開発レベルであれば無料枠で始められるケースが多いので、最初から固定費をかけずに公開まで持っていきやすいのが強みです。

⚠️ 注意:ドメイン(店名)はどっちにしろ必要
Vercelを使っても、myapp.vercel.app のような初期URLのままで良いなら困りません。
ただし、オリジナルのURL(=店名にあたる独自ドメイン)が欲しければ、結局ドメイン取得サービスでドメイン(店名)だけは用意する必要があります。
とはいえ、ドメイン代は年間1,000円〜程度なので、サーバー代がかからない分、Vercel構成の方が維持費は安くなりやすいです。

ドメイン取得は「Xserver」「ConoHa WING」でも可能ですが、ブログを使わない場合は「Value Domain」「ムームードメイン」「お名前.com」なども有名です。

まとめ:適材適所で使い分けよう

「サーバー」という言葉にアレルギーを持つ必要はありません。
作りたいものに合わせて、適切な場所(出店の仕方)を選ぶだけです。

  • ブログを書いて情報発信したい → レンタルサーバーを契約してWordPressを入れる。
  • プログラミングで自分のサービスを作りたい → Vercelのアカウントを作って無料枠からデプロイする。

仕組みがわかったら、次は実際に作るための「道具」を準備しましょう。

-🔰基礎技術